Artington Group certifies as a B Corp

04 March 2024: Artington Group has announced its certification as a B Corporation (or B Corp), joining a growing group of companies reinventing business by pursuing purpose as well as profit.  Artington Group, which comprises the commercial law firm Artington Legal and legal services provider Clearly Business Law, has been certified by B Lab, the not-for-profit behind the B Corp movement, as having met rigorous social and environmental standards which represent its commitment to goals outside of shareholder profit.
 
The B Corp certification addresses the entirety of a business’ operations and covers five key impact areas of Governance, Workers, Community, Environment and Customers. The certification process is rigorous, with applicants required to reach a benchmark score of over 80 while providing evidence of socially and environmentally responsible practices relating to energy supplies, waste and water use, worker compensation, diversity and corporate transparency. To complete the certification, the company will legally embed its commitment to purpose beyond profit in their company articles.
 
Artington Group’s businesses, Artington Legal and Clearly Business Law are now part of a community of 7,000 businesses globally who have certified as B Corps. The B Corp community in the UK, representing a broad cross section of industries and sizes, comprises over 1,500 companies and include well-known brands such as The Guardian, innocent, Patagonia, The Body Shop and organic food pioneers Abel & Cole.
 
Recent attention on the legal industry makes Artington Group’s B Corp certification a notable step and signals a shift towards greater accountability and transparency in the sector.

There are currently over 1,500 B Corps in the UK and 7,000 worldwide. Other legal industry B Corps include Anthony Collins Solicitors, Bates Wells, Brabners, Cripps, KaurMaxwell, EMW Law, Hartley Law, Joelson, Muckle and Stephens Scown.

     

About B Lab UK:
B Lab UK is transforming the economy to benefit all people, communities, and the planet. A leader in economic systems change, our global network creates standards, policies, and tools for business, and we certify companies—known as B Corps—who are leading the way. To date, our global community includes over 7,000 B Corps in 90 countries and 161 industries, and over 150,000 companies manage their impact with the B Impact Assessment and the SDG Action Manager.
